Output 27ce6af8dc6b8476f81aa0ffd61393e580ffbf158f91dea25db36aaeb1ae04c6:1

value
587753
script pubkey
OP_0 OP_PUSHBYTES_20 819c5238cbf7e84ce4933ef0e829bcfe699eeb05
address
bc1qsxw9ywxt7l5yeeyn8mcws2dule5ea6c9t62dpn
transaction
27ce6af8dc6b8476f81aa0ffd61393e580ffbf158f91dea25db36aaeb1ae04c6
confirmations
151769
spent
true